The easy 1.5-mile trails leads visitors from the dunes along Chesapeake Bay to beside the bird banding stations used for research. Since 1963 Kiptopeke has been site to migratory bird research. The coastal area funnels thousands of raptors and songbirds each fall. This trail also passes a lovely butterfly garden where the migratory Monarch butterfly frequents.
Directions: From Chesapeake Bay Bridge Tunnel, This serene park is located on Virginia's eastern shore three miles north of the Chesapeake Bay Bridge Tunnel on Rt. 13. Be prepared to pay a hefty one-way bridge toll. Follow the main park road until you come to a large picnic, playground, shelter and observation deck on your left. The trail begins behind the observation deck.
Elevation: 25 feet
Elevation Gain: Minimal
Distance: 1.5 miles
Difficulty: Easy
